Cyclopedia of Biblical, Theological and Ecclesiastical Literature [6]

(Hebrews Kabbon', כִּבּוֹן, in Syriac, A Cake; Sept. Χαββών v. r. Χαβρά and Χαββά ), a place in the "plain" of Judah, mentioned between Eglon and Lahmam ( Joshua 15:40); possibly the same with Machbenah ( 1 Chronicles 2:49). It is perhaps the modern ruined site el-Kufeir, marked byVan de Velde (Map) at 10 miles south-east of Ashkelon.

International Standard Bible Encyclopedia [7]

kab´on ( כּבּון , kabbōn  ; Χαβρά , Chabrá ): An unidentified place in the Shephelah of Judah near Eglon ( Joshua 15:40 ). It is possibly the same as Machbena .
